Google has launched Gemini Enterprise, a powerful new AI platform designed to help companies automate their workflows and improve efficiency. The announcement came at the Gemini at Work 2025 event hosted by Google Cloud. Unlike the basic Gemini assistant in Google Workspace, Gemini Enterprise is a full-stack AI system that connects with all parts of a business and understands company data across multiple platforms.
Gemini Enterprise is built on Google’s most advanced AI models. It is not just a chatbot. While employees can still interact with it via text prompts, the platform goes beyond simple questions and answers. It can understand context from Google Workspace, Microsoft 365, Salesforce, SAP, and other tools to give meaningful responses and assist with tasks. This makes it a central hub for enterprise operations.
One of the key features of Gemini Enterprise is the no-code workbench. This allows teams to build AI agents that can handle specific workflows automatically. Companies can either use pre-built agents or create custom ones to suit their needs. For example, marketing, finance, or HR teams can deploy AI agents that automatically manage tasks like report generation, data analysis, or scheduling.
A major challenge in creating AI agents is data access, since businesses use multiple systems. Google solves this by connecting Gemini Enterprise to different knowledge hubs, making it easy to gather and process data from a single interface. The platform also includes central governance, which lets companies secure, monitor, and audit all active AI agents in one place.
Google emphasized that Gemini Enterprise is built with openness in mind, connecting with over 100,000 partners. This ecosystem approach allows businesses to choose tools, expand AI capabilities, and encourage innovation across departments.
